Community Stages Presents: Elements at Play A Steampunk Folktale Adventure for All Ages! Step into a world of imagination, culture, and adventure with Elements at Play, a fast-paced, interactive theatre experience designed for audiences of all ages—kids, parents, and grandparents alike! Our Trunk & Trek Troupe, a dynamic ensemble of steampunk-inspired young performers (ages 8-17), will bring to life thrilling folklore from Ireland, Mexico, South Africa, and the Seminole Nation—all woven together through the powerful forces of earth, air, fire, and water. What to Expect: Live, immersive storytelling—actors create characters, settings, and entire worlds before your eyes. Humor & heart—crafted to entertain everyone from ages 5 to 105.
A cultural journey—experience how global traditions connect us all through the natural elements.
Steampunk flair—curious treasures (“Oddbits”) spark inventive, hands-on storytelling.
